That\u2019s something to be appreciated.<\/p>\n<p>The Spikes are the Single-A short-season affiliate of the St. Louis Cardinals. The stadium in which they play is located on the campus of Penn State, in the shadow of the famed Beaver Stadium. That, of course, makes parking plentiful (though it did cost, if I remember right, $3). And if you get there early enough, as we did, you had the chance to walk around the massive stadium before heading over to the smaller, more comfortable Medlar Field at Lubrano Park.<\/p>\n<p>The stadium seats about 5,500 people and is home to the Penn State baseball team, as well as the State College Spikes. A nice piece to this stadium is being able to see Mount Nittany beyond the outfield wall.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_7501\" style=\"width: 310px\" class=\"wp-caption alignright\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-7501\" data-attachment-id=\"7501\" data-permalink=\"https:\/\/hoohaa.com\/?attachment_id=7501\" data-orig-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?fit=500%2C500&amp;ssl=1\" data-orig-size=\"500,500\" data-comments-opened=\"1\" data-image-meta=\"{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.2&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;iPhone 5s&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1404478948&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.12&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;40&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.00053590568060021&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;}\" data-image-title=\"sc2\" data-image-description=\"\" data-image-caption=\"&lt;p&gt;A free program is always welcomed!&lt;\/p&gt;\n\" data-medium-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?fit=300%2C300&amp;ssl=1\" data-large-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?fit=500%2C500&amp;ssl=1\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-7501\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?resize=300%2C300&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"A free program is always welcomed!\" width=\"300\" height=\"300\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?resize=300%2C300&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?resize=150%2C150&amp;ssl=1 150w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?resize=184%2C184&amp;ssl=1 184w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?resize=175%2C175&amp;ssl=1 175w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?resize=144%2C144&amp;ssl=1 144w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/hoohaa.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/07\/sc2.jpg?w=500&amp;ssl=1 500w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px\" \/><p id=\"caption-attachment-7501\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">A free program is always welcomed!<\/p><\/div>\n<p>To be honest, this is definitely one of the top New York-Penn League stadiums I have been to.<\/p>\n<p>When entering, the team store is close by and, for a lower-level team, the store is stocked with everything one might need. The items \u2013 shirts, jerseys, hats, balls and most things you expect to find \u2013 are reasonably priced and there are plenty of sizes. With such a cool logo, I walked out with a nice shirt.<\/p>\n<p>After exiting the store, the field is straight ahead, and is below the concourse level, so you walk down to your seats. The seats are of the fold-down variety, but are solid and roomy.<\/p>\n<p>But, if you want to roam, you can do so and not lose sight of the game. There are picnic tables spread throughout the concourse area, as well as a picnic area in left field. Right field features an area with high-top tables, as well as a bleacher section at the top of the right-field wall. That\u2019s a very cool aspect of the stadium, I thought. Kind of a \u201ccheap seat\u201d type feel, which is excellent for a baseball stadium.<\/p>\n<p>The netting behind home plate extended a little further, it seemed, than many parks. To be fair, the few times I passed by it, I didn\u2019t see many \u2013 if any \u2013 in there.<\/p>\n<p>The concessions were pretty strong, including a Burgatory spot (very good burgers), a craft beer stand and a spot just for ice cream. There is also normal ballpark fare, but when I went to get lunch, my plan was a hot dog and a bratwurst (I think it was bratwurst\u2026), but they didn\u2019t have the specialty, so I just went with a couple of hot dogs. They were above average, but nothing fully special. Their fries were decent.<\/p>\n<p>I attended on July 4, too, so the area was having a full celebration and fair of sorts. Later in the evening, they open the park up so people can watch the fireworks (which apparently are ranked No. 3 in the country \u2013 I can believe it). We took one of the high-top tables in right field and enjoyed the show, so that\u2019s another bonus.<\/p>\n<p>In the end, this is a solid, stadium and one worth attending.
